Z25 Need for immunization against other single viral diseases
Z25 is the ICD-10 code for Need for immunization against other single viral diseases. It is a three-character category divided into 3 subcodes; use the subcode whenever the record supports that level of detail. It belongs to the block Z20–Z29 (Persons with potential health hazards related to communicable diseases) in Chapter XXI, Factors influencing health status and contact with health services.
